A Preliminary Study On Molecular Systematics Of Cymbellaceae Diatoms In The Freshwater

Abstract/Summary:
Cymbellaceae belongs to Bacillariophyta,Bacillariophyceae,and Cymbellales,which is a natural group with rich species.At present,there are more than 4000 taxonomic units of the family Cymbellaceae reported in the world,and more than 400 taxonomic units have been reported in China.In the traditional taxonomic study of Cymbellaceae,the most prominent taxonomic feature of this group is the asymmetry of the apical axis,which is usually dorsiventral;The main basis for identification is the shape of valves,the striae,the raphe and the stigma.However,the differences between some different species in the same genus are subtle and the identification is difficult.In this paper,light microscope and scanning electron microscope were used to observe and categorically identify the morphological and structural characteristics of the isolated and cultured species of Cymbellaceae,and to explore the morphological and taxonomic characteristics of the family.In parallel,sequencing analysis of 18 S rDNA,28 S rDNA,rbcL and psbC gene sequences was performed on the isolated and purified algal strains,and the relationships among each genus and among various species of the genus were further analyzed by constructing single gene and multigene molecular phylogenetic trees by Maximum Likelihood and Bayesian Inference techniques.The main results are as follows:1.Approximately more than 400 taxa have been reported for the diatoms of the Cymbellaceae in China.We have collated the reported cases of Cymbellaceae from various regions of China;2.65 strains were isolated.These are identified as 8 genera and 19 taxa including7 taxa in Cymbella,9 taxa in Encyonema,1 taxa in Cymbopleura and 2 taxa in Qinia.Morphological descriptions of these species are provided,with illustrations;3.Based on Gen Bank,the published molecular information of Cymbellaceae has been sorted out.Cymbella has 212 sequences;Cymbopleura has 32 sequences;Encyonema has 116 sequences;Encyonopsis has 8 sequences;Karthickia has 5sequences;Placoneis has 54 sequences;Reimeria has 8 sequences(as of 2023.02.28).In this study,235 species sequences of Cymbellaceae have been obtained,and 112 sequences have been submitted to Gen Bank;4.Selecting 23 morphological characters to construct morphological phylogenetic trees for 22 genera of Cymbellaceae.Using four gene sequences of 18 S rDNA,28 S rDNA,rbcL and psbC,two phylogenetic trees were constructed: Maximum likelihood(ML)and Bayesian inference(BI).The main results are as follows:(1)The morphological phylogenetic tree shows that Alveocymba and Cymbopleura are the more primitive genera of the family Cymbellaceae,and Cymbella and Kurtkrammeria are the more advanced genera;(2)The topological structure of the phylogenetic tree jointly constructed by single gene and multiple molecular markers supports morphological identification,and there is a strong relationship among the genera.It is found that Seminavis,Encyonema and Placoneis are all monophyletic groups,and the information of Reimeria species samples is comparatively less,but the current research shows that it may be a monophyletic group.At the same time,Cymbella,Cymbopleura and Encyonopsis formed multiple branches,and the three may be multiphyletic groups;(3)Different clades of Cymbella are associated with different groupings within the genus.Combined with morphological analysis,this study found that the tumidula/mexicana group often clustered into two branches,one was Cymbella tumida,and the other included Cymbella mexicana and Cymbella janischii,which clustered with Cymbella proxima as sister clades;Cymbella aspera clustered as one branch,consistent with the morphological grouping;5.18 S rDNA,28 S rDNA and rbcL genes were used to construct Maximum likelihood tree(ML)and Bayesian inference tree(BI).Based on the combination of morphology and molecular phylogenetics,the results show that three of the strains we studied belong to two species of the genus Qinia,two of which belong to a proposed new species Qinia hubeii Liu & Kociolek sp.nov.;another new species is Qinia wuhanensis Liu & Kociolek sp.nov..On the phylogenetic tree,the two are sister branches and have a close relationship with the Encyonopsis.Our study supports that Qinia hubeii Liu & Kociolek sp.nov.and Qinia wuhanensis Liu & Kociolek sp.nov.represent an independent genus,Qinia,whose morphologically most obvious feature is that the apical pore field is bisected by the distal end of the raphe and the areolae are elliptic with projections that occlude the openings,giving the appearance of a ā€œCā€ shape.Qinia forms a large branch with Encyonopsis,Cymbella,and Cymbopleura,and Qinia is closely related to Encyonopsis.This study provides reference data for the classification and molecular research of Cymbellaceae.
